Baby responding to touch!

After spending the morning running around, doing jobs in town, cleaning and baking, I put my feet up on the sofa and read a book. I had my palm resting on my belly, holding my book. I started to notice bub was kicking my palm! Generally kicks have been pretty low, so i was suprised it was kicking so high! I remembered hearing/reading about bub responding (by kicking) to external touch to the uterus. I thought it was a long shot, but moved my palm and pressed two fingers a few inches below my belly button, along my midline. To my suprise, bub almost straight away kicked my fingers! After a few kicks a moved my hand back to the original spot and very soon bub was kicking there again! I repeated this pattern a few times, and it was amazing! Bub responded quickly, and with such strong kicks! So amazed to be able to interact with bub like this!! Im 24 weeks tomorrow.. Has anyone else experienced this yet too?!

    ekscopp said:

    I'm only 21 weeks but today I haven't been feeling the baby move barley at all. I usually feel the baby pretty frequently and haven't been this worried. Anyone experience the same thing? Do you think I should call the doctor?

    I'd say it's a little soon to freak out. Docs don't have moms to be tracking movement until 28 weeks because movement up until then isn't necessarily consistent. Your baby could just be having a laid back day like we sometimes do outside the womb :) or he could be sleeping! If it will give you peace of mind it doesn't hurt to call the doc, but I don't think you should worry at this point.
